0

Vue3 + React18 + TS4入门到实战 系统学习3大热门技术 | 更新完结

sdedw
6天前 6

获课:97it.top/232/

在数字化转型的浪潮中,前端架构的每一次技术选型都直接关乎企业的研发效能与长期商业回报。近年来,随着Vue生态向Pinia的全面演进以及React生态对Zustand的狂热追捧,状态管理工具的更迭已不再是单纯的代码重构,而是一场深刻的工程经济学博弈。从商业视角审视,Pinia与Zustand的较量,本质上是企业在“官方标准”与“极简自由”之间寻找最优解的战略抉择。

首先,拥抱Pinia是Vue系企业实现降本增效、降低沉没成本的必然选择。作为Vue核心团队官方推荐的状态管理方案,Pinia精准解决了传统Vuex时代样板代码冗长、TypeScript支持孱弱的历史包袱。它通过移除繁琐的Mutations机制,将开发者的认知负担降至最低,使团队能够以更少的代码量完成同等复杂的业务逻辑。更重要的是,Pinia与Vue DevTools的原生深度集成,为大型项目提供了强大的可观测性与调试能力。对于拥有庞大Vue资产的企业而言,采用Pinia意味着选择了最平滑的技术演进路线,这不仅大幅降低了新员工的培训成本,更保障了未来十年内框架维护的安全底线。

其次,Zustand的崛起则代表了企业对极致性能与跨端扩展性的商业诉求。在React乃至原生JS生态中,Zustand以不到2KB的极小体积和彻底摆脱Provider包裹的无依赖设计,赢得了追求轻量级架构团队的青睐。它的核心商业价值在于其内置的选择器(Selector)机制与细粒度订阅模型,能够在高频数据更新场景下避免不必要的组件重渲染,从而为企业节省可观的计算资源与带宽成本。此外,Zustand不绑定特定框架的特性,使其成为构建微前端架构或跨平台应用时的绝佳桥梁,赋予了企业在复杂技术栈切换时极高的战略灵活性。

然而,任何技术选型都必须警惕隐性成本。在企业级应用中,过度追求Zustand的自由度可能会带来团队协作上的挑战。由于缺乏强制的代码规范约束,当团队规模扩大时,极易陷入状态管理混乱的泥潭;相比之下,Pinia模块化且规范的Store设计,天然更适合几十人甚至上百人的大型研发团队协同作战。因此,真正的商业决策不应盲目跟风,而应基于当前的技术底座进行精准匹配:Vue3项目应将Pinia作为毫无争议的首选,以最大化生态红利;而在React生态中,中小型敏捷团队或高性能可视化场景应果断拥抱Zustand,而对于需要严格规范的大型企业级React项目,或许Redux Toolkit依然是更为稳妥的压舱石。

综上所述,Pinia与Zustand的选型博弈没有绝对的赢家,只有最契合当下业务的优解。卓越的商业洞察要求技术管理者跳出纯粹的代码优劣之争,将研发效率、团队基因、维护成本与未来扩展性纳入统一的评估矩阵。唯有如此,才能在这场状态管理的变革中,将前沿技术的红利转化为企业持续增长的强劲动能。


本站不存储任何实质资源,该帖为网盘用户发布的网盘链接介绍帖,本文内所有链接指向的云盘网盘资源,其版权归版权方所有!其实际管理权为帖子发布者所有,本站无法操作相关资源。如您认为本站任何介绍帖侵犯了您的合法版权,请发送邮件 [email protected] 进行投诉,我们将在确认本文链接指向的资源存在侵权后,立即删除相关介绍帖子!
最新回复 (0)

    暂无评论

请先登录后发表评论!

返回
请先登录后发表评论!